Wendy (Baldwin) Tallents

Wendy (Baldwin) Tallents passed away on September 12, 2026, at the age of only 67, two months shy of her 68th birthday. Born as the youngest child to Doris and Raymond Baldwin, she spent most of her life in Fulton, NY before relocating to Oak Island, NC to be closer to her children, grandchildren and the ocean in 2016.

She was a force, she felt passionately about the world, her children, her grandchildren, cooking delicious food, eating the delicious food she cooked, music, dancing and walking on the beach.
Cooking was her love language; she loved nothing more than to share the food she made with the people she loved and she passed that love of food on to her daughters and granddaughters.

As a young mother in the early 1980’s she worked tirelessly to provide her children with a good life, as she evolved through her own life, she was always a supportive mother, mother-in-law and grandmother often attending her grandchildren’s sporting and arts events.  Watching her granddaughters sing was a great source of happiness for Wendy. She had the soul of an artist, whether she be cooking, weaving, creating stained glass art or sewing, making things with her hands brought her great joy. Her laugh was infectious, and she was capable of immeasurable delight. She loved music and could often be found dancing in the garage to the sounds of Stevie Ray Vaughn at her home in Oak Island with her husband.

She is survived by her husband Brace Tallents, her eldest daughter Jessica Gaffney and partner John Lothes, her middle daughter Sonya and husband Kyle Henry, her youngest daughter Blake and husband Kelly Fulcher and her grandchildren Abigail, Mason, Ralf, Norah, Brayson, Landyn, and RayLynn.   Wendy is survived by her sister Beverly and husband Sal Cavallaro, her brother John Bladwin and many nieces, nephews, great nieces, great nephews, sisters-in-law and brothers-in-law.  Wendy is gone too soon and will be so missed.

In lieu of flowers the family would like you to consider a donation to the Susan G. Komen Breast Cancer Foundation.
